TVGB: "It appears hope of Splinter Cell: Conviction making its way to the PlayStation 3 at a later date may have faded a bit more. During Ubisoft's fiscal year 2009-10 Q3 conference call today it was once more said that the game will be an exclusive to the already announced platforms, those being the PC and Xbox 360."

TVGB: "Ubisoft CEO Yves Guillemot has confirmed that next to PlayStation 3, Xbox 360 and PC, the newly-announced Ghost Recon Future Solder will also be making its way to the Wii, PlayStation Portable as well as the DS. The CEO revealed the platforms during the company's fiscal year 2009-10 Q3 conference call
a few moments ago when asked to clarify on whether or not the game will be released on multiple consoles."
